口服天竺葵油或茴芹油可通过油的抗氧化作用改善与抑郁相关的大鼠症状。

Oral supplementation with geranium oil or anise oil ameliorates depressed rat-related symptoms through oils antioxidant effects.

Abstract

Background Depression is a psychiatric disease condition and the chronic mild stress (CMS) model is a well-known and valuable animal model of depression. Geranium oil and anise oil were chosen for such a study. The aim of this research was to establish the geranium oil and anise oil effect to ameliorate CMS-related symptoms. Methods This research included 80 male albino rats each group of 10 rats and the animals were divided into two major groups: normal and CMS. The normal group was subdivided into four (control, geranium oil, anise oil and venlafaxine drug) subgroups treated orally with saline, geranium oil, anise oil and venlafaxine drug, respectively, for 4 weeks. The CMS group was subdivided into four (CMS without any treatment, CMS + geranium oil, CMS + anise oil and CMS + venlafaxine drug) subgroups treated orally with geranium oil, anise oil and venlafaxine drug, respectively, for 4 weeks. Results The sucrose consumption in sucrose preference test, the distance traveled test and center square entries test were decreased, while center square duration test, immobility time in tail suspension test and floating time in forced swimming test were increased in CMS. The superoxide dismutase, glutathione peroxidase, glutathione-S-transferase, glutathione reductase and catalase levels decreased but malondialdehyde and nitric oxide levels increased in brain cerebral cortex and hippocampus areas in CMS. The oral intake of geranium oil and anise oil pushes all these parameters to approach the control levels. These results were supported by histopathological investigations of both brain cerebral cortex and hippocampus tissues. Conclusions Geranium oil and anise oil ameliorate CMS-related symptoms and this effect were related to the antioxidant effects of oils.

摘要

背景

抑郁症是一种精神疾病,慢性轻度应激(CMS)模型是一种著名且有价值的抑郁症动物模型。本研究选用了天竺葵油和茴芹油。本研究的目的是确定天竺葵油和茴芹油改善CMS相关症状的效果。方法:本研究包括80只雄性白化大鼠,每组10只,动物被分为两大组:正常组和CMS组。正常组再细分为四个(对照、天竺葵油、茴芹油和文拉法辛药物)亚组,分别口服生理盐水、天竺葵油、茴芹油和文拉法辛药物,持续4周。CMS组再细分为四个(未治疗的CMS、CMS + 天竺葵油、CMS + 茴芹油和CMS + 文拉法辛药物)亚组,分别口服天竺葵油、茴芹油和文拉法辛药物,持续4周。结果:在CMS组中,蔗糖偏好试验中的蔗糖消耗量、旷场试验中的行进距离试验和中央方格进入试验均降低,而中央方格停留时间试验、悬尾试验中的不动时间和强迫游泳试验中的漂浮时间均增加。CMS组大脑皮层和海马区的超氧化物歧化酶、谷胱甘肽过氧化物酶、谷胱甘肽 - S - 转移酶、谷胱甘肽还原酶和过氧化氢酶水平降低,但丙二醛和一氧化氮水平升高。口服天竺葵油和茴芹油使所有这些参数接近对照水平。大脑皮层和海马组织的组织病理学研究支持了这些结果。结论:天竺葵油和茴芹油可改善CMS相关症状,且这种作用与油的抗氧化作用有关。
